Information icon Hi, and thank you for your contributions to Wikipedia. It appears that you tried to give Pure And Easy a different title by copying its content and pasting either the same content, or an edited version of it, into another page with a different name. This is known as a " cut-and-paste move", and it is undesirable because it splits the page history, which is legally required for attribution. Instead, the software used by Wikipedia has a feature that allows pages to be moved to a new title together with their edit history.

In most cases, once your account is four days old and has ten edits, you should be able to move an article yourself using the "Move" tab at the top of the page (the tab may be hidden in a dropdown menu for you). This both preserves the page history intact and automatically creates a redirect from the old title to the new. If you cannot perform a particular page move yourself this way (e.g. because a page already exists at the target title), please follow the instructions at requested moves to have it moved by someone else. Also, if there are any other pages that you moved by copying and pasting, even if it was a long time ago, please list them at Wikipedia:Cut-and-paste-move repair holding pen. Thank you. Share thoughts WRT Cover sections on songs

Hey. I hope you don't mind this post, I came across you when I was exploring the talk page of another user. On that talk page, you had posted a section detailing some changes you made to a cover section on the article of a song. Said talk page & discussion can be seen here User_ User Talk (Aspects) Is She Really Going Out With Him?

All of the out of the way. I've recently seen some articles where I feel covers are given undue weight in articles about the original song. You appeared to express a similar feeling in that talk page above. What I'm hoping for, perhaps, is some advice or guidance to use an editor that might be help me determine if a cover is given undue weight in an article, or maybe any guidelines from Wikipedia that may support this sort of idea? As far as I can see in the article about style guidelines for song articles, the only mentioning of cover songs is simply listing the minimum criteria for them to be mentioned in an article. There's no real guideline or outline as to how in depth this detailing should, or should not, be. ThereWillBeTime ( talk) 23:33, 17 January 2021 (UTC) reply

Hello, glad to hear from you! I agree that it's a tough call to decide just how notable covers are; I'm definitely not averse to giving popular song covers their due (for instance, the Van Halen version of "You Really Got Me" or the Elvis Costello version of "Peace, Love and Understanding") but clunky infoboxes for every random cover, for me, totally disrupts the flow of an article. I'd say the kinda loose criteria I use is:
1) Whether there are any significant sources about the background and recording of the cover (as opposed to just chart success)
2) How the cover's commercial success compares to the original song
3) Whether the information in the rendition's section fills up the space needed to prevent the infoboxes from stacking up in an incomprehensible way.
The covers on "Is She Really Going Out with Him" had pretty much no background info, were dwarfed in commercial success by the original, and, on a desktop, made the spacing between sections awkward, so I condensed them into one section. I don't know how helpful this is, but I'd say this is how I kinda went about it. Beatleswhobeachboys ( talk) 19:45, 18 January 2021 (UTC) reply
